GABS Brewer 2017 – Athletic Club Brewery

GABS Brewer: Craig Blackmore from Athletic Club Brewery

What sort of beer are you making for GABS?
We’re brewing a Wheatwine, an American style that’s made predominantly from Wheat Malt and has an abv. closer to that of wine than your average beer (as the name suggests).

What’s it called?
Wheat Wine and a Three Day Growth. It’s a nod to Barnesy and the Cold Chisel boys. Thanks to our drinking buddies for having such PUNderful minds & helping us with naming duties.

Where did the inspiration come from?
It’s a style I’ve not brewed or seen readily available in Australia, so I thought it might be fun to try something new and challenging. We only opened our brewery doors in November 2016 and we’ve never brewed something with such a high abv., so it’s definitely going to be an interesting brew day!

What’s the weirdest ingredient you’ve ever added to a beer?
Typically, we brew beers that are true to style to provide our drinkers with good examples of various styles, so we haven’t really gotten too weird yet! However, we do have a Choc Vanilla Milk Stout coming out in a few weeks for Easter that we used 9kg of Cacao Nibs & 6.5L of Vanilla Extract. It’s a chocolate (and stout) lover’s dream!!

GABS drinking preference – tasting paddles or a full glass?
Tasting Paddles all day! It’s the best way to taste as many of the wonderful & unique beers on offer, some of which you’ll never get a chance to drink ever again! It might take a bit longer to get served, so preparation is key!
